11 Facts About Don Mattrick

1.

Donald Allan Mattrick was born on 13 February 1964 and is a Canadian businessman who previously served as the CEO of social gaming company Zynga and the president of the Interactive Entertainment Business at Microsoft.

2.

In 1991, Don Mattrick was the chairman and the majority owner of DSI while Canadian businessman Tarrnie Williams served as CEO.

3.

Don Mattrick served in a variety of leadership positions at Electronic Arts and, prior to leaving the company in 2005, served as the president of Worldwide Studios for Electronic Arts where he oversaw EA's global studios and research and development in several major sites, including Redwood Shores, California, EALA in Los Angeles, EA Tiburon in Florida, EA Canada in Vancouver, British Columbia, and Montreal, and EA UK in Chertsey, England.

4.

In July 2007, Don Mattrick officially joined Microsoft as a senior vice president overseeing the Xbox 360 and PC gaming businesses, with his oversight apparently leading to an increase in video game installations and Xbox LIVE subscriptions.

5.

Don Mattrick is largely credited for his work in developing Kinect for Xbox 360.

6.

Don Mattrick unveiled Kinect under the code-name of "Project Natal" at E3 2009 on stage with Steven Spielberg to positive reception.

7.

In October 2010, Don Mattrick was promoted to president of the Interactive Entertainment Business, overseeing a range of consumer businesses including Xbox 360, Xbox LIVE, Kinect, Music, and Video, as well as PC and mobile interactive entertainment.

8.

In May 2012, Don Mattrick was named one of CNN Money's top 10 brilliant technology visionaries.

9.

On May 21,2013, Don Mattrick unveiled the new Xbox One, the successor to the Xbox 360, an all-in-one entertainment system.

10.

Don Mattrick left Microsoft on July 1,2013 to join Zynga as CEO and would eventually be replaced by Phil Spencer as Head of Xbox in 2014.
